Some advice......you are doing 29ish sets for legs with high reps.


Cut those sets in half and get the rep renge(TUT interval) down in the hypertrophy range.

Reps are too high and too many sets.

WHy 15 reps??


why not 6?

No offense....but the number of reps(only) has little to do with gaining size, which you stated was the main goal.

Im aware of Scott Abel...and his wife Laura Binetti(IFBB pro)....he desgined his first plans around HER....if you dont know who she is - find out.

She originally competed at 170ish pounds and was a freak.....thing is...she was bigger than most female bbers BEFORE she began training.

Hey - ff you feel that you are on the right track - knock it out then.


I STRONGLY suggest getting a bf test done NOW to track progress if you havent already done so.
